At the last meeting of the G7 finance ministers, they mainly discussed the topic of the war in Ukraine. And how Ukraine can be restored? after the war. The conference was already coming to an end when the very controversial idea of \u200b\u200b“buying out” Russian oligarchs from sanctions was suddenly expressed. Reported by Handelsblatt.

Canadian Finance Minister Chrystia Freeland told her six fellow ministers that Russian oligarchs who are on Western sanctions lists are calling her and are very unhappy with them..

And not just because of the inconvenience of travel restrictions and asset freezes.. Allegedly, they, too, the oligarchs, are critical of Russia’s aggressive war against Ukraine, but cannot distance themselves from the invasion because of the threat of reprisals from the Kremlin.

The essence of the proposal is simple:

the Russian oligarchs who fell under sanctions voluntarily donate a significant part of their fortune to the restoration of Ukraine, and sanctions are lifted from them for this..

The German edition characterizes this idea as follows:.

“Such a deal could bring certain benefits for all parties: Kyiv gets billions, the West avoids the expropriation debate, and Russian entrepreneurs get their luxury life back.”.
